Saturday just wasn't the day for Valley Catholic's offense. They lost 10-0 to the Seaside Seagulls on Saturday. The game snapped a strange streak: the last five times these teams have met, it?s been the away team that?s taken home the W.
Valley Catholic's loss was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 7-12-1. As for Seaside, with the victory, they broke their four-game losing streak and moved their record to 5-11.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Valley Catholic will face off against Rainier at 3:30 p.m. on Monday. The Columbians have struggled to contain batters this season (they've allowed 10.56 runs per game on average), something the Valiants will no doubt try to take advantage of. As for Seaside, they will square off against Astoria at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day.
